Delhi-NCR Hit by Early Morning Quake: 4.0 Magnitude Earthquake Sends Shockwaves Through Region
On the morning of February 17, 2025, Delhi-NCR was rocked by a 4.0 magnitude earthquake that sent shockwaves through the region. The quake’s epicenter was near Dhaula Kuan, and it was felt across the entire NCR area, including in Delhi, Noida, and Ghaziabad.
The tremors caused widespread panic, with residents rushing outdoors. Some people even reported hearing a deep rumbling sound before the tremors began. “It was unlike anything I’ve felt before,” said Arvind Kumar, a resident of South Delhi. “My entire building swayed for a few seconds. It was terrifying.”
Despite the initial shock, no major damage or injuries have been reported. Authorities have advised the public to remain cautious and follow standard earthquake safety protocols. National authorities are conducting a full assessment of potential risks and aftershocks.
